Well this week we showed our film, ‘A Walk in the Park‘ at the Kino Shorts 42 night in Manchester.

The film went down well and I did a brief Q&A afterwards.

I have mixed feelings about this film.  On the whole I’m reasonably happy with it, the performances are good, but watching it with an audience I became aware that it wasn’t really working, cinematically.

Let me explain.

I wrote the script for ‘A Walk in the Park‘ about a year ago.  It was an idea I had, you guessed it, while walking in the park.  One of those great moments where you have an idea and it all comes together relatively quickly.  Writing the script was easy, one draft, the dialogue just flowed out of me onto the page and I just kept going until it was done.
